Lafayette Christian Academy junior quarterback Ju’Juan Johnson put Madden-like numbers in the Knights’ 68-46 win over Teurlings Catholic in the Division II (Select) Semifinals as he completed 25 of 36 passes for 473 yards and 6 TDs while also having 24 carries for 176 yards and 3 more TDs on the ground.
